T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- Deputy Director of Garuda Indonesia Thomas Oentoro said that there are five contingencies in the notes on the company's financial report on June 30, 2025. All five contingencies are related to legal proceedings amidst a capital injection of Rp23.6 trillion from the Investment Management Agency of Daya Anagata Nusantara or Danantara.
Thomas said that Garuda Indonesia is facing lawsuits from Greylag Goose Leasing 1410 Designated Activity Company and Greylag Goose Leasing 1446 Designated Activity Company. These lawsuits are parked at the Singapore International Arbitration Centre (SIAC).
"Up to now, it is still in process at SIAC, and there has been no decision on this case," he said in a disclosure at the Indonesia Stock Exchange on Friday, November 7, 2025.
In addition to the arbitration lawsuit in Singapore, Thomas said that Garuda Indonesia is also facing a request for Suspension of Debt Payment Obligations through the US Chapter in the United States (US). Garuda Indonesia has withdrawn the Chapter 15 process in the PKPU Plan and has submitted a notice of Withdrawal on May 24, 2023 to the United States Bankruptcy Court, Southern District of New York. "Up to now, the case is still open in the Court," he said.
Aside from the United States, Thomas said that Garuda Indonesia is also facing a request for PKPU in France. Currently, the PKPU recognition process is still ongoing in the Paris Court. "There has been no decision from the Paris Court, and the company always coordinates with the related lawyers regarding the handling of this legal process," he said.
Thomas added that in February 2025, Garuda Indonesia also filed a cassation legal effort to the Supreme Court regarding the appeal decision against Greylag Goose Leasing 1410 Designated Activity Company and Greylag Goose Leasing 1446 Designated Activity Company. This cassation request is also still in process. "There has been no legally binding decision regarding this legal case," said Thomas.
Currently, according to Thomas, Garuda Indonesia is also facing a lawsuit from PT Royal Shafira Wisata against its subsidiary, PT Citilink Indonesia. This lawsuit is still in the examination process at the Central Jakarta District Court. "Undergoing the third mediation stage according to the prevailing laws and regulations," he said.
By the end of this month, Garuda Indonesia will receive a US$1.4 billion or Rp23.6 trillion capital injection from Danantara. This capital will be disbursed at the Extraordinary General Meeting of Shareholders on Wednesday, November 12, 2025.
Thomas detailed that 37 percent or Rp8.7 trillion of this fund is for Garuda Indonesia's working capital, which includes aircraft maintenance and repair costs. Meanwhile, 63 percent or Rp14.9 trillion is for Citilink's working capital.
Regarding the capital in Citilink, Thomas said that Rp11.2 trillion is for working capital and Rp3.7 trillion is for the payment of aircraft fuel purchase debts.
In the previous announcement, the capital from Danantara to Garuda Indonesia will be determined at the Extraordinary General Meeting of Shareholders on Wednesday, November 12, 2025.
This additional capital is implemented because Garuda is expected to not record positive equity until November 2025, thus hindering access to funding and posing the potential for delisting from the Indonesia Stock Exchange. On the other hand, Garuda is also under pressure due to aircraft maintenance and restoration that have lowered the company's and Citilink's performance.
Garuda Indonesia recorded a loss of US$180.7 million or Rp3 trillion (exchange rate 16,654 per US dollar) until the third quarter of 2025. This loss decreased from the same period last year, which was US$129.6 million or Rp2.1 trillion.
